Guardian has been a staple of Christian hard rock since their debut, First Watch in 1989. Jamie Rowe, formerly of Tempest, joined in 1991 and soon after that, they released the full-length Fire and Love (1991). After 33 years the band decided to call it a day after seven albums, in which we thought we would see the last of Jamie.
Of course, for those of us who have been following his journey, we were wrong….
![](https://themetalonslaught.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/09/Kalamity-Kills.jpg)
Not only featuring in other projects during his long stint at Guardian, Jamie has since been working on a brand new project called Kalamity Kills, which released a single, “Sinners Welcome“, back in September 2022. And now that group has announced their debut, a self-titled full-length that will be dropping on September, 15th, 2023.
Their second single “Burn“, released yesterday on all streaming services, with the addition of an official lyric video.
